AUD extends deadline for vocational courses to July 5
LAST DATE FOR APPLYING TO BA (HONS) WAS ORIGINALLY SATURDAY, BUT THIS WAS ALSO EXTENDED TO JULY 5
NEWDELHI: Ambedkar University Delhi (AUD) said on Saturday it has extended the last date for submission of applications for three Bvoc programmes to July 5, from June 23. The last date for applying to four new BA programmes at Karampura campus and seven BA (Hons) programmes at Kashmere Gate is also July 5.
AUD offers three Bvoc programmes in tourism and hospitality, retail management, and early childhood centre management and entrepreneurship at their Karampura campus, with 32 seats each. The last date of application for these programmes was originally set to be June 23.
“We extended the date of application for these programmes to July 5, to bring the last date for all undergraduate programmes at par,” AUD spokesperson Anshu Singh said.
The admission to Bvoc programmes is based on an aptitude test and interview. The dates for these will also be extended, but a final date is “still being finalised and will be communicated soon,” according to Singh.
The last date for applying to BA (hons) programmes offered at AUD’S Kashmere Gate campus was originally supposed to be Saturday, but this was extended to July 5.
AUD had introduced four new BA programmes at their Karampura campus, and the last date to apply to these was decided to be July 5.
Singh had earlier said they had extended the dates for the Kashmere Gate BA courses, to bring it at par with these.
The admissions to all BA programmes are based on cutoffs, and the first cutoff is expected on July 9. As a state university, it reserves 85% of its seats for Delhi students, and issues two cutoffs for Delhi and outside Delhi students.
